Avid to FCP 7 via Automatic Duck Question
Trying to export an avid project to FCP 7 via AAF and automatic duck. Wondering if anyone was in the know on this.
The Avid project is all AMA stuff linked to huge masters of all file types all over the server, so…
On AAF export, I’m consolidating to DNxHD 100, 60 frame handles, all to one folder and it mentions some files are different time base, etc. and if I want to convert. So I let it and all seems well. I get an AAF file and a folder of Avid Media Files.
In FCP, I’ve installed the Avid Codecs. And automatic duck. So I use the Automatic Duck import, choose “use existing” and it imports and creates .mov references to the avid mxf files.
The resulting sequence audio is perfect. But I get the big duck on the screen that says it’s files that automatic duck can’t understand. The titles came across, and all the crops, moves, etc. came across, but all I can see is a wireframe with the big duck.
Everything seems perfect. Just can’t see the media/codec for some reason. Do I also have to install some mxf plugin? Like I said, so far we have the duck and avid codec plugins.
We also installed the CalibratedQ plugin trial. We can play the avid mxf files in the finder.
This is all on the same computer too if that helps.
